[ty] typecheck dict methods for TypedDict (#19874)
## Summary
Typecheck `get()`, `setdefault()`, `pop()` for `TypedDict`
```py
from typing import TypedDict
from typing_extensions import NotRequired
class Employee(TypedDict):
name: str
department: NotRequired[str]
emp = Employee(name="Alice", department="Engineering")
emp.get("name")
emp.get("departmen", "Unknown")
emp.pop("department")
emp.pop("name")
```
